Allergies cause itchy eyes, coughing, sneezing and even a sore throat. Most allergy symptoms seem like an ongoing cold, but you can effectively manage it! Read on to learn how to get rid of common allergy symptoms.

Suffer from seasonal allergies? Be sure to wash hair, change clothes and shower every time you come in from the outdoors. If you don’t, you may make your allergies worse because you will bring allergens in your home.

Discuss your allergy problems with a professional, and request a skin test. Skin tests can tell you what things you are allergic to. Simply knowing what is causing your allergies, can make it easy to make lifestyle adjustments to avoid them.

If your child has food allergies, pack safe foods when traveling. Sometimes, it is hard to find out all of the ingredients and preparation methods for certain foods, which increases the risk that they could contain nuts, soy, dairy, corn or other common food allergy triggers.

If your eyes feel dry and itchy, don’t use your hands to rub them. Invest in antihistamine eye drops to control such symptoms. If you keep rubbing your eyes, you may irritate the follicles near your eyelashes, which can lead to styes.

Are you aware of the fact that your body itself may actually cause allergic episodes? It can be true! All throughout the day, your body takes in lots of pollen and dust which can stick to your clothes and hair. In the evening, especially during sleep, these allergens can cause harm to your airways. To avoid this, make sure that you shower and clean constantly. If you don’t, you’ll suffer from more reactions.

Smoking should be an absolute taboo for people who suffer from allergies. Allergens can clog up sinus passages and make it difficult to breathe. Smoking also makes it hard to breathe. In addition, smoke can cause you to have allergic reactions. Steer clear of smoking and the smoke of others if you really want to help yourself.

Always store garbage outside of your home. Garbage stored indoors will attract vermin and other pests. Insect and rodent droppings can cause allergies. If you can’t get rid of the rodents, consider trapping them. If that doesn’t work, consider poison.

For the sake of safety, test antihistimines from home. Often antihistamines will have ingredients that induce drowsiness. Even if the box doesn’t say it may cause drowsiness, test them at home where you can relax before driving while taking them.

To avoid cross-contaminating foods with the foods that cause allergies, try making allergy-free foods for everyone. Ridding your home of all allergy-inducing foods is the best way to keep your family safe.

If airborne allergens are a major problem for you, then purchase a purifier that uses HEPA filters. Using these filters will help lessen allergens that cause allergies. Shop around for a filter that contains a cleanable filter, as this will save you money in the long term, since you won’t have to keep stocking up on disposable filters.

TIP! You do not have to fight allergies by yourself. Though you might believe you are resigned to a lifetime of horrible symptoms, there is hope available.

Avoid having too much carpet or too many rugs in your home. These accents are a hotbed for dust and pollen accumulation. If you have to have rugs in your home, make sure that you buy washable rugs and remember to wash them every couple of weeks to remove allergens.

If you have been outside for some time, more than likely you picked up unwanted airborne allergens. Make sure you take a shower before you go to bed. A shower will rinse off any lingering pollen or allergens. These allergens can get into your hair or coat your skin.

Consider removing out your carpet. Carpet is infamous for dead dust mites, pollen and dust. If your home has wall-to-wall carpet and you have the money to do some remodeling, rip it out and replace it with hardwood or tile floors. This will make an amazing difference in the amount of allergy-causing substances you breathe. If getting rid of your carpet isn’t feasible, vacuum daily instead.

While playing in piles of crunchy leaves is fun, keep your kids out of them if they have mold allergies. If left out in wet conditions, fallen leaves can host mold and mildew capable of causing breathing problems for young kids. Clear your yard of leaves regularly.
